WebJan 1, 2024 · Digital nerves are intrinsic to the sensory and motor function of the hand. These nerves represent the terminal ramifications of the ulnar, median, and radial nerves and are located distal to the carpal tunnel and Guyon canal. In the upper arm the radial nerve wraps around the back … WebOct 26, 1997 · The hand is supplied by three major nerves: the median, ulnar, and radial nerve. The ulnar and median nerve enter the hand on the palmar side. The radial nerve crosses the radial styloid from the volar to the dorsal surface at the wrist. These nerves control the wrist, fingers, and thumb's motion and sensation. (See Figure 1.)
